Warning Signs You Need Dehumidification Services
High humidity levels can be a sign of a larger issue, and 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s down the line. Here are some common warning signs that show you need dehumidification services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of excess moisture in your home. If you notice musty smells that persist even after cleaning,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a leak or high humidity levels.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of excess moisture. If you notice your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s time to call our team.
Peeling Paint and Wallpaper
Peeling paint and wallpaper can be a sign of high humidity levels. If you notice your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Mold and Mildew Growth
Mold and mildew growth can be a sign of excess moisture. If you notice mold or mildew growing in your home, it’s time to call our team.

Common Questions About Dehumidification Services
How Long Does Dehumidification Take?
Dehumidification times can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work closely with you to create a personalized plan that suits your needs and budget. Typically, dehumidification can take anywhere from a few hours to several days.
Is Dehumidification Covered by Insurance?
Dehumidification services may be covered by your insurance policy, depending on the cause of the damage and your policy terms. Our team will work closely with you to understand your coverage and ensure that you receive the compensation you deserve.
Can I Prevent Dehumidification Issues?
Yes, you can prevent dehumidification issues by maintaining a healthy humidity level in your home. This can be achieved by using a dehumidifier, ensuring good ventilation, and addressing any water leaks quickly.
